Biography
Luke Gibson, Peter Jermyn, Jim Jones, Pat Little and Mike McKenna formed Luke the Apostles in the mid-'60s. After success in small clubs and coffeehouses, the band released one single, "Been Burnt," but broke up soon after. Gibson then joined Kensington Market, while McKenna joined the Ugly Ducklings and later McKenna Mendelson Mainline. Little joined Transfusion, which became Crazy Horse. Luke the Apostles re-formed in 1970, recording one popular single; they broke up for the second time later that year. ~ John Bush, Rovi
